We ain't twisting anything.
Conservatives are standing with the US Constitution.
One of the key elements of the US Constitution is that it designates the Supreme Court as the final arbiter of constitutional disputes. You don't always have to agree with their rulings (heaven knows I don't), but you do have to follow them. Claiming that states are free to interpret the Constitution for themselves - and ignore SCOTUS rulings if they conflict - is a fundamental violation of the Constitution.

Trump was on the ballot in 2016 and 2020 and if he’s not on it this year it’s because he was removed .
Howie Hawkins was on the ballot in 2020. He's not on in 2024. That's not because he was removed, it was because he didn't apply.

You don't keep ballot access every election year. You have to apply, present paperwork, and qualify every election to get onto the ballot.

If, for example, a Candidate in 2020 moved out of the country, and changed their permanent address, etc, so that they have not been a US resident for the past 14 years come 2024, their applications to be placed onto the ballot would be rejected, since they fail one of the requirements to be eligible president.
